Meisner Technique | The Acting Studio - New York The Meisner technique has three main components that all work hand in hand: Emotional preparation; Repetition ; Improvisation; Meisner felt that the process of activating "affective memory" in the scene removed the actor from the live moment; therefore, his fundamental principle was presence and an intense observation of a scene partner.
